MADO Kiosk Wall Graphic
Designed for the MADO kiosk at Kozyatağı City’s AVM, this wall graphic transforms the brand’s visual language into a large-scale spatial application.
The composition combines MADO’s signature blue with a dynamic milk splash and ice cream visual, creating a strong focal point behind the kiosk. The aim was to strengthen brand visibility within the space while integrating the graphic naturally into the overall retail environment.

From Maraş to World
Wall Graphic Concept
This wall graphic concept was developed to translate MADO’s heritage into a large-scale visual experience.
Inspired by Kahramanmaraş, the compositions bring together the Ahir Mountains, traditional Maraş architecture, and MADO’s iconic ice cream. Two different flavor variations were created within the same visual system, using color, texture, and product focus to build distinct atmospheres while maintaining a consistent overall concept.

MADO China Wall Graphic
This wall graphic was designed for a MADO branch in China, translating the brand’s heritage and visual identity into a large-scale interior application.
The composition brings together traditional ice cream craftsmanship, a global visual reference, and MADO’s signature product in a contemporary illustration style. The aim was to create a strong focal point within the space while communicating the brand’s origins, craftsmanship, and international presence through a single visual narrative.

PizzaBulls Event Stand Experience
This project was developed for PizzaBulls’ event presence, covering the visual design and on-site application of the stand and its supporting communication materials.
The work included stand graphics, roll-up designs, price posters, printed inserts and event collateral, creating a consistent and recognizable brand presence across the entire space. Beyond the design process, I was also involved in the on-site setup and documented the event through photography and video, allowing the project to be carried from concept to real-world execution.
